The Reducing Readmissions market is a subset of the Healthcare Services industry that focuses on reducing the number of patients who are readmitted to a hospital within a certain period of time after being discharged. This is done by providing services such as patient education, medication management, and follow-up care. These services are designed to help patients better manage their health and reduce the risk of readmission. Additionally, hospitals and healthcare providers are increasingly utilizing technology to improve patient outcomes and reduce readmissions. This includes the use of predictive analytics, telemedicine, and remote patient monitoring.
